Diversification is a crucial strategy for investors looking to build a robust and resilient investment portfolio. By spreading your investments across different asset classes, sectors, and geographies, you can reduce the potential impact of any single investment on your overall portfolio performance. This can help you minimize risk and maximize returns over the long term. The concept of diversification is based on the principle that not all investments move in the same direction at the same time. Different assets have different risk-return profiles, and by combining them in a thoughtful manner, you can create a portfolio that is able to weather different market conditions. For example, during periods of economic growth, equities tend to perform well. But during economic downturns, fixed-income investments like bonds may outperform stocks. By including both equities and bonds in your portfolio, you can potentially capture upside during bull markets while mitigating downside risk during bear markets. In addition to asset classes, diversification also extends to sectors and geographies. By investing in a mix of sectors, such as technology, healthcare, and financial services, you can benefit from the growth opportunities in these different industries while reducing sector-specific risks. Likewise, investing in different geographies can help diversify currency and geopolitical risks. However, diversification should not be seen as a means to eliminate all risk. While it can help reduce the impact of poor-performing investments, it cannot guarantee profits or protect against losses. Proper diversification requires careful asset allocation, ongoing monitoring, and periodic rebalancing to ensure your portfolio remains aligned with your investment goals and risk tolerance.
